Using Downsells to Improve Profits
Downsells take the pricing down a notch from an upsell, but it still adds more overall profits to the funnel for yourself and the affiliate - and more value for the buyer.After agreeing to buy the front end offer, and declining the upsell or one time offer, give them an opportunity to grab a downsell item.
So for instance, if you have an upsell of a course with videos, PDFs and a webinar training, the downsell might eliminate one or two items and leave just one - like the webinar only at a smaller price.
